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$4,148 in Foster City, CA versus $2,687 in Baltimore, MD.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$5,845 in Foster City, CA versus $4,020 in Baltimore, MD.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$7,542 in Foster City, CA versus $5,354 in Baltimore, MD.

Living in Foster City, CA is roughly 54% more expensive than in Baltimore, MD, driven mainly by Getting Around.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Foster City, CA 210% above, Baltimore, MD 101%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$2,995 in Foster City, CA and $1,827 in Baltimore, MD.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Foster City, CA pays 64%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$71.0 in Foster City, CA vs $79.0 in Baltimore, MD for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$408 vs $429 per month, with Foster City, CA cheaper across the board.
